Literature summary extracted from

  • Vazquez, C.; Mejia-Tlachi, M.; Gonzalez-Chavez, Z.; Silva, A.; Rodriguez-Zavala, J.S.; Moreno-Sanchez, R.; Saavedra, E.
    Buthionine sulfoximine is a multitarget inhibitor of trypanothione synthesis in Trypanosoma cruzi (2017), FEBS Lett., 591, 3881-3894 .

Inhibitors

EC Number Inhibitors Comment Organism Structure
6.3.1.9 DL-(S,R)-buthionine sulfoximine DL-(S,R)-BSO, a multitarget inhibitor of trypanothione synthesis, in vivo effects on nonthiol-supplied epimastigote cells, on Cys-supplied epimastigote cells, and on GSH-supplied epimastigote cells, overview. Inhibition of gamma-glutamylcysteine synthetase and trypanothione synthetase. Wild-type Trypanosoma brucei cells are not restored by supplementing with 0.08 mM GSH. The the L-(S,R)-BSO stereoisomer is more potent that the the D-(S,R)-BSO. Inhibitor docking analysis, binding structure Trypanosoma cruzi
